Further note:
The symbol _R is causing problems. Some header must be
defining it as a constant. I've replace _R with inR in:
modinteger/*.h
numtheory/cl_nt_sqrtmodp.cc
Now all the source compiles, but link fails with:
d: cl_prin_globals.lo has external relocation entries in non-writable
section (__TEXT,__StaticInit) for symbols:
cl_module__cl_prin_globals__dtorend
cl_module__cl_prin_globals__ctorend
/usr/bin/libtool: internal link edit command failed
Looking into this I've come across CL_PROVIDE and CL_PROVIDE_END
which appear to require assembler and which are not defined for _ppc_.
Somebody else will have to tackle this one.
